if the duck traveled 97.8 miles at top speed in 1.5 hours how far did it travel in one hour?

It travels 65.2 miles in one hour. To calculate the rate, you use the equation distance/time=rate. So, you divide 97.8 (the distance) by 1.5 (the time) and you get 65.2 miles per hour, which is the answer.
